A Window to the Soul

He looked into her eyes.
Those huge, blue eyes, so beautiful!
Yet filled with such sadness…
How had she gotten to this point?
Where did she go from here?
He knew there was no way to help her.

Those eyes could tell a million tales…
But her lips won’t move to voice them.


Debbie Black
